International Freshman Scholarship for Undergraduate Students in USA, 2018

The Kent State University in USA invites applications for the International Freshman Scholarship program available to any non-immigrant to the United States who is an incoming New Freshman student to Kent State University.

This merit-based scholarship may vary in the amount awarded to the student.



Worth of Award

A renewable award will be distributed to qualifying individuals, range from $2,000 to $20,000 per year

 ELIGIBILITY

New freshman only (transfers are not eligible);
Fall admission only
Minimum cumulative Secondary school GPA 3.6 on US 4.0 scale
27 ACT Composite,1280 new SAT or 1210 old SAT Critical Reading & Math
Unconditional Admission to Kent State University as a freshman
How to Apply

Students will be automatically considered for the scholarship if they apply by the deadline.
Deadline

Students must have been admitted to Kent State University by February 15.
Scholarship recipients will be notified of their award in April.
